Express first aid courses
These are brief, focused sessions that generally compete half a day to one full day. They cover core first aid skills: handling bleeding, cracks and strains, burns, shock, fainting, asthma, allergies, and commonly standard CPR.
The express first aid training model functions well if:
You have actually never ever done a course and need a strong structure. You want a recognized first aid certificate for volunteer or freelance job. You remain in a significant hub city between trips and can save a solitary day.
Trainers typically boost the speed by trimming extensive talks and utilizing scenario‑based teaching. As an example, as opposed to describing the physiology of shock for half an hour, they imitate a scooter collision outside the class and have you handle it, after that debrief. For adult learners that travel, this style is typically more interesting and memorable.

Express childcare first aid courses
If you are a traveling household, an au pair, or a remote worker that periodically helps with child care abroad, a general first aid course is insufficient. Children are not just tiny adults, and babies are different again.
Express child care first aid courses, sometimes called express childcare first aid training, focus on:
Choking in infants and young children. Fever management and febrile seizures. Typical childhood injuries in travel atmospheres. Pediatric CPR and recuperation positions.

These express childcare first aid courses can be surprisingly compact, usually a half day, since they assume you currently have some basic first aid knowledge or combine necessary adult content with pediatric specifics. For nomad moms and dads and long‑term residence caretakers, I rank this as vital training, not a luxury.

What to search for in a fast first aid course provider
Not all fast first aid training is created equivalent. Advertising language can be generous, and it is simple to perplex a glossy web site with strong guideline. When you review service providers in a city you are travelling through, take notice of a few important points.
First, accreditation and recognition. Does the first aid course comply with requirements from an acknowledged authority, such as a national resuscitation council, a major humanitarian organization, or a government regulator? The precise body differs by country, however a reputable carrier will certainly discuss whose standards they follow.
Second, trainer experience. Ask who shows the course. Experienced fitness instructors usually have histories as paramedics, nurses, wild overviews, lifeguards, or similar duties. Travelers take advantage of teachers who can speak about improvised remedies, minimal resources, and genuine traveling circumstances, not only textbook office incidents.
Third, class size and equipment. Compressing material is something. Crowding thirty individuals around a single manikin is another. An excellent fast first aid course keeps the teacher to student ratio workable and offers sufficient training equipment that you spend the majority of the practical session doing, not watching.
Fourth, adaptability around language and context. If you are in an area where you do not talk the key language, confirm whether the course runs in English or supplies multilingual guideline. Likewise ask whether the scenarios and instances attend to situations travelers deal with: roadway events, water activities, hiking, food hygiene concerns. Common corporate case studies concerning storage facility injuries are less relevant.
Finally, clear certification information. If you require a first aid certificate for job or visa objectives, verify the exact file you will certainly receive, its credibility duration, and whether it can be confirmed online. Some countries are particular about size and content, particularly for work that involve youngsters or higher risk environments.

Packing a minimal first aid set that matches your training
Your first aid training is the software. Your traveling first aid set is the hardware. They should match.
Many travelers lug protruding sets full of things they do not recognize just how to use, then neglect to restock fundamentals. Instead, concentrate on a portable kit that sustains what you in fact discovered in your fast first aid course or express first aid course.
Here is a straightforward, traveler friendly design that pairs well with common first aid training:
Wound treatment: adhesive tapes, sterilized gauze pads, adhesive tape, alcohol wipes or saline pods, and a tiny tube of antiseptic cream. Support and immobilization: a roll of natural bandage or flexible wrap, which can support strains or safe and secure dressings. Medications: fundamental discomfort relief suitable to you, oral rehydration salts, and any type of individual prescriptions in original packaging. Protection and tools: nitrile handwear covers, a portable CPR face guard, tiny scissors, and tweezers. Extras for particular journeys: if heading to remote or high danger areas, take into consideration additional clean and sterile dressings, an added plaster, or things recommended by your fitness instructor or traveling clinic.Everything needs to fit in a little pouch that stays in your daypack, not buried at the end of your travel luggage. A first aid kit only helps if you can reach it when you actually require it.
